皇冠体育app and the United States should properly handle and control differences to protect the relationship's progress from being distracted, President Xi Jinping told US Secretary of State John Kerry in Beijing on Sunday.
The vast Pacific Ocean has enough space to accommodate the two big nations of 皇冠体育app and the US, said Xi, urging both sides to work together, enhance communication and trust, and deepen cooperation.
Xi's remarks came as Beijing's made another call for increasing dialogue between the two countries during the top US diplomat's visit to 皇冠体育app on Saturday and Sunday, amid growing tensions in the South 皇冠体育app Sea.
During their separate meetings with Kerry on Saturday, both Foreign Minister Wang Yi and Fan Changlong, vice chairman of 皇冠体育app's Central Military Commission, stressed 皇冠体育app's determination to safeguard its sovereignty and territorial integrity.
皇冠体育app's relationship with the US is stable, said Xi, adding he looks forward to continuing to develop this relationship with US President Barack Obama and to bring the ties to a new height along a track of a new model of major country relationship.
Kerry, during the meeting with Xi at the Great Hall of the People, highlighted the relationship's importance, saying both sides are able to handle and control differences in a mature manner.
He called for greater cooperation between the two countries, and said the extensive US-Sino cooperation has showed the world the important roles they have played in addressing major global and regional affairs.
Xi said he looks forward to having sincere and in-depth communication with Obama about the 皇冠体育app-US relationship and major issues of common concern during his scheduled visit to the US in September.
In June, the seventh 皇冠体育app-US Strategic and Economic Dialogue and the sixth 皇冠体育app-US High-Level Consultation on People-to-People Exchange will be held in the US.
